Wilfred Aucoin
Wilfred Aucoin SHEDIAC, NB - The death of Wilfred Aucoin, 71, of Shediac, occurred Saturday, August 28, 2004 at the Dr. Georges-L. Dumont Hospital following a lengthy illness. Born in Cheticamp, NS, May 4, 1933, he was the son of the late Christopher Aucoin and the late Emma Roach. Prior to his retirement, he was employed at Canada Post as manager with 35 years service in Toronto, Campbellton, Moncton and Ottawa. He was a member of U.C.T. Council in Campbellton for 32 years, past president of the Campbellton Minor Hockey, and Campbellton Salmon Festival. He was also involved with Cheticamp Hospital and St-Pierre parish committees. He will be sadly missed by his loving wife of 47 years, Claudette (Poirier) Aucoin; three children, Giselle Ayles (Jeff) of Brampton, ON, Robert (Lorraine Deland) of Orleans, ON, Garry (Lise) of Shediac; five sisters, Marie-Hélène Chiasson (Raymond), Rita Breininyer (Joseph), Lorette MacGilvray (Eugene) all of Cheticamp, NS, Elizabeth Nugent (Albert) of Sydney, NS, Thérèse McCue (Bill) of Hamilton, ON; two brothers, Albert of Oshawa, ON, Marcelin (Ethel) of Cheticamp, NS; six grandchildren, Jason, Sean, Justin, Jordan, Wesley, Kiana; several nieces and nephews.
